Types of BMW 1 Series Keys
The BMW 1 Series utilizes a range of keys, each created for particular models and years. Understanding the kind of key you have is vital for an effective replacement.
Key TypesKey TypeDescriptionConventional KeyA basic key that does not have any electronic elements.Remote Key FobA key with remote locking and unlocking capabilities, geared up with electronics.Keyless Entry KeyA fob enabling keyless entry and beginning, frequently referred to as a smart key.Key FeaturesTransponder Chip: Most modern-day keys included a transponder chip that communicates with the vehicle's immobilizer system, making sure that only the best key can start the engine.Battery: Fob keys generally have a battery that might require replacement occasionally.Emergency situation Key: Most fobs include a physical key for manual entry.The Importance of Replacement Keys

Replacing a BMW 1 Series key is a procedure that can frequently be finished in several ways. Below are the most typical techniques for acquiring a replacement key.
Replacement Methods
Go To a BMW Dealership
Pros: Guaranteed compatibility, access to original maker parts.Cons: Generally the most pricey choice.
Automotive Locksmith
Pros: Usually more economical than a car dealership, and can sometimes provide service on-site.Cons: Requires locksmith to have BMW Locksmith key shows knowledge.
Online Retailers
Pros: Potential for lower costs.Cons: Risk of receiving non-genuine parts; might complicate programs.The Replacement ProcessCollect Required Documents: This usually consists of evidence of ownership, your lorry identification number (VIN), and individual identification.Select Your Method: Decide whether to go through a dealer, locksmith, or online seller based upon cost and benefit.Program the New Key: Depending on the key type, you may need to have it programmed to your vehicle. This may require unique devices that is usually readily available at dealerships or certified locksmith professionals.Costs Involved in Replacement
The cost of replacing a BMW Key Battery Replacement Near Me 1 Series key can vary significantly depending upon the technique selected and the type of key.
Estimated CostsReplacement MethodApproximated Cost RangeBMW Dealership₤ 250 - ₤ 500Automotive Locksmith₤ 150 - ₤ 300Online Retailers₤ 50 - ₤ 150 (plus programs)Factors Affecting CostKey Type: Smart keys and remote keys are normally more costly than traditional keys.Configuring Fees: If programming is needed, this can include a service charge.Time Sensitivity: Fast service may incur extra costs.FAQs About BMW 1 Series Replacement Keys1. How long does it require to get a replacement key for my BMW 1 Series?
The time it takes can vary. If going through a dealer, you may anticipate to wait for a number of hours, while a locksmith may use a more instant service.
2. Can I replace my BMW key myself?
While acquiring a key is possible through online sellers, programming typically needs specialized devices that many owners do not have access to, making professional assistance advisable.
3. What occurs if I lose my only key?
If you've lost the only key you have, it's vital to act rapidly. Contact either a car dealership or a qualified locksmith to discuss your alternatives for a replacement.
4. Are replacement keys covered under guarantee?
Generally, lost keys are not covered under standard car warranties. Check with your particular policy for protection information. 
5. Can I configure my new key in your home?
Most of the times, it is best to leave programs to experts due to the intricacies associated with the BMW Key Lost key shows procedure.
